Benefits Of Having Wheelchair Ramps At Your Home:

Increase Independence And Mobility:

Ramps are designed to increase the mobility and capability of individuals. Access ramps play an important role in helping people with physical disabilities to move from one place to another freely. Because of ramp slopes, they are not dependent on others.

Enhances The Appearance Of The House:

The ramp slope also helps to enhance the look of your house. Modern access ramps are made from various materials. Modular ramps are made up of aluminum, wood, etc whereas permanent ramps are made of concrete. You can choose the ramp according to the theme and decor of your house. 

Convenient For Everyone:

Ramps are not only useful for people with mobility issues but for normal individuals also. Other people also take advantage of access ramps. People use access ramps to easily transport heavy items. These are also used by seniors of the family who find it difficult to climb the stairs. 

Added Safety:

Ramps make it safe for disabled people to move from one place to other. These also provide safety during rainy and harsh weather conditions. According to the ADA slope calculator, it is necessary to have hand drills. 

Improves Home’s Resale Value:

Having access ramp slopes also has financial benefits. Adding access ramps directly affects the overall worth of a home or property. People are ready to pay the asked amount because it makes the house more appealing. 

Confidence:

People with mobility issues are mostly frustrated. Ramp slope helps by boosting confidence in disabled people. They can move from one place to another with confidence.
